Is it possible that the serene beauty of the Nakaragi Shrine is closely linked with the stunning cherry blossoms? Nakaragi Shrine is a peaceful place of worship in northern Kyoto. It is known for its beautiful weeping cherry trees. These trees create a stunning tunnel of bright pink petals during the sakura season.

The Nakaragi Path is a pedestrian alley. It runs along the Kamo River. It sits between Kitaoji-bashi and Kitayama-ohashi bridges. This approximately 800-meter-long stroll unfolds under a tunnel of bright pink petals. It is truly enchanting.

Beyond Demachiyanagi, the banks of the Kamo River are covered in Japanese cherry trees. They bloom in the spring. They brighten both sides of the river for about six kilometers. People walking or cycling enjoy stopping under the long, flowery branches. They take a pleasant break for contemplation.

The Nakaragi Path is on the left bank of the Kamo River. That is the eastern side when going upstream. Locals know this spot for its weeping cherry trees. These trees are a species specific to Japan. They call them shidarezakura. These weeping cherry trees are distinctive. They have bright pink and sometimes red drooping flowers. This differs from the common somei yoshino sakura. Those blossoms are a light pink. The blooming peak usually happens later. It makes the season a little longer.

Nakaragi Path is bordered by about 70 shidarezakura. Their branches were laid on bamboo pergolas. This creates the sakura tunnel effect when they are in full bloom. Nakaragi Shrine is one of the very few places in Kyoto where you can walk under weeping cherry trees. Heian Jingu’s gardens are the other one.

On a beautiful day in late March to early April, the walk is enchanting. Young couples often take advantage of this natural decor for wedding pictures. After the blooming peak, flowers fall from the cherry trees. Green leaves replace them. This provides some green and coolness in the summer.

Next to Nakaragi Path, the Kyoto Botanical Gardens offer a beautiful visit. They feature blooming cherry trees gathered in its Sakura-bayashi wood.
